Market Overview

Hydrodesulfurization catalysts play an essential role in petroleum refining by removing sulfur compounds from crude oil derivatives and producing cleaner transportation and industrial fuels. These catalysts improve fuel quality while helping refiners comply with increasingly strict environmental regulations governing sulfur emissions. Cobalt molybdenum and nickel molybdenum catalysts remain widely used because of their effectiveness in refining diesel, gasoline, and other petroleum products.
